I have the 2010 Copperhead Koup SX. This is a smashing orange color that no one else quite does this well! The SX is the best, this one with 6 speed manual. I get better mileage than the EPA rating, recently drove from Raleigh, NC to Northern Virginia and got 34.5 MPG averaging 65 MPH, not bad at all! Had my adult kids in the car, all three, and no one complained of the rear seat room, in fact they were surprised at the room. The trunk is adequate, I didn't expect more than that. I love the exterior styling and have read that the designer is formerly of Audi, which would explain the great looks. I de-badged the car, put a stylized K on the front and rear in place of the KIA badge. I'm retired military, KIA means "killed in action" and I just could not look at that all the time. :-) I also put Koup wheel inserts on the car, and a shark fin antenna makes a nice touch. I get a lot of people asking what kind of car it is. :-) The ride is actually pretty good for a sporty car although I'd like to have independent rear suspension. That would make a huge difference in the car's ability to handle bumps in corners. The steering is very quick, only 2.4 turns lock to lock. That adds to the quick feel of the car and makes parking lots easier. It also has a good turning circle since it's so short. The engine, the 2.4L, is peppy for sure although the manual transmission coupled with traction control makes getting full use of the power difficult. If you want to really get on it, turn off the traction control since wheel spin is almost inevitable and will trigger the reduction in power. Shifts are a bit notchy, and I have trouble with 2nd gear when the car is cold. I also find the run-on between gears bothersome, others have mentioned this too. I may look for a fix. What I really like about the Kia is the added features for the money. This model has heated side view mirrors, wiper blade defroster!, heated seats, red lighting on the instruments, excellent Bluetooth technology (but would like to have A2DP for streaming music (available in the 2012 models)) and fast electric windows. Navigation was not included, and I prefer that since I use my iPhone for that. The only issues so far, from a reliability standpoint, have been a leaky passenger headlight (being replaced under warranty of course) and the aforementioned transmission shifting issue which I'll get looked after. Great car, I want the colored inserts for the 17" wheels to become available in my color!
